Question: Let A [ ] be an array of n real ( decimal ) numbers, uniformly distributed from 1 to 1 0 0 . A student
Let A be an array of n real decimal numbers, uniformly distributed from to A student would like to print out the smallest t n numbers in increasing order. Consider the three approaches below: OPTION k n p SelectA n k Loop through A and store all items that are less than or equal to p in a list L Sort list L in increasing order, using QuickSort. Print L OPTION Setup Bucket sort using equallysized buckets in the range to Bucket covers the range to inclusively. Distribute the points into buckets. Run insertion sort on the elements of bucket Print out the sorted elements from bucket OPTION Loop through input A and set m to be the maximum element found Use Counting sort with maximumsized element m Print out the first n elements from the resulting sorted array
Step by Step Solution
There are 3 Steps involved in it
1 Expert Approved Answer
Step: 1 Unlock
Question Has Been Solved by an Expert!
Get step-by-step solutions from verified subject matter experts
Step: 2 Unlock
Step: 3 Unlock
